When selecting a trip on automobile, particularly a battery-powered vehicle, it's vital to comprehend the battery size and charging requirements. Ride-on cars and trucks usually come with 6V batteries, 12V batteries, or 24V options.


The Facts About School Bus Transportation Revealed


When it comes to ride-on cars, the 2 main types of batteries you'll encounter are lead-acid and lithium-ion. Lead-acid batteries, typically discovered in standard models, are heavier and have a longer charging time but are typically more cost-effective. Lithium-ion batteries, on the other hand, are lighter, charge much faster, and generally last longer, making them a fantastic choice for more sophisticated models.


Carpool RidesCar Service For Kids
Charging times can vary considerably in between designs. Usually, lead-acid batteries may take 8-12 hours to fully charge, while lithium-ion batteries can charge in 3-6 hours - Individual Rides. It is necessary to follow the maker's directions to guarantee battery longevity. Overcharging can lower the battery life, so utilizing a timer or charging over night might not always be the very best approach.
